EXCLUSIVE: Vertigo Releasing has acquired UK-Ireland distribution rights to Ben Leonberg’s debut feature Good Boy.
The distributor will release the film in UK-Ireland cinemas on October 10.
Good Boy follows a loyal canine companion named Indy who leaves city life with his owner to a long-vacant country home. After moving in, Indy becomes wary of the old house, including phantasmagorical warnings from a long-dead dog.
The film debuted at SXSW this year, with Indy – also the name of the dog performer – winning the ‘Howl of Fame’ award for best canine performance.
It is produced by Kari Fischer and Leonberg; Independent Film Company will release the film in North America on October 3.
“UK & Irish theatrical audiences will undoubtedly find this perspective-driven horror as unique and refreshing as we did,” said Vertigo CEO Rupert Preston. “Indy the dog gives a standout performance.”
It joins a Vertigo slate that includes Lisa Barros D’Sa and Glenn Leyburn’s Saipan, about the falling out between Ireland captain Roy Keane and manager Mick McCarthy at the 2002 football World Cup.
